Bathroom Upgrades Improve Basic Amenities at Lander’s Popular Rodeo Grounds

  • Local Champion: City of Lander, Wyoming
  • Date Funded: February 24, 2025
  • Grant Amount: $29,100

Lander’s rodeo grounds serve as a hub of community activity year-round, hosting daily events at the indoor arena run by the Lander Old Timer’s Rodeo Association and numerous gatherings at the city-owned outdoor arena, including the popular Pioneer Days Rodeo. Despite this regular use, the property’s only bathrooms lack basic amenities—stall doors don’t close properly, there’s no soap or paper towels, and the push-button sinks provide only cold water that stops flowing the moment you let go. When an outreach coordinator noticed these inadequacies while hosting an educational event for local third graders, she reached out to LOR for support. LOR’s funding will help replace stall doors, install new sinks with proper faucets and hot water, add soap dispensers, and improve lighting, ensuring all residents using these facilities have access to privacy and proper sanitation, while also supporting the city’s efforts to attract more events to this community resource.
